Compare all specifications:
1996 Audi A3 | 2011 Mercedes-Benz E | |
Make | Audi | Mercedes-Benz |
Model | A3 | E |
Year Released | 1996 | 2011 |
Body Type | Hatchback |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1595 cc | 2143 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 100 HP | 201 HP |
Torque | 136 Nm | 500 Nm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.3:1 | 16.2:1 |
Top Speed | 190 km/hour | 250 km/hour |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| 7-speed shiftable autom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 1134 kg | 1700 kg |
